Power line filter modules, such as the NAM-30-471-DXE, are used to protect electronic circuitry from high voltage between the power line and the grounded chassis of a device. The module is typically used in consumer electronics such as sound systems, television sets, personal computers, and other electronic products. The filter works by shielding the circuitry from excessive voltage, which could potentially damage or destroy the device.
The NAM-30-471-DXE power line filter module is an example of a low pass filter. Low pass filters are used to attenuate higher frequency signals while allowing lower frequency signals to pass. The filter is composed of several components including a pair of capacitors and an inductor. The two capacitors, a series and a parallel connected capacitor, are used to block higher frequency signals, such as electromagnetic interference (EMI), from entering the circuitry. The inductor is used to reduce noise from within the device itself.
